7.4 Event counter mode
7.4.1 Setting for event counter mode
Figures 7.4.2 and 7.4.3 show an initial setting example for registers related to the event counter mode.
Note that when using interrupts, set up to enable the interrupts. For details, refer to “CHAPTER 6.
INTERRUPTS.”
Fig. 7.4.2 Initial setting example for registers related to event counter mode (1)
The counter divides the count source frequency by (n + 1)
when counting down, or by (FFFF16 – n + 1) when counting up.

Selecting event counter mode and each function
Timer Ai mode register (i = 0 to 9)
(Addresses 5616 to 5A16, D616 to DA16)
Pulse output function select bit
0: No pulse output
1: Pulse output
Count polarity select bit
0: Counts at falling edge of external signal.
1: Counts at rising edge of external signal.
Up-down switching factor select bit
0: Contents of up-down register
1: Input signal to TAiOUT pin
Selection of event counter mode
Setting divide ratio
